The construction of road tunnels is an important part of road infrastructure. The operation of road tunnels has historically been accompanied by a number of extraordinary events. Fires are among the most dangerous ones. Individual countries create their own safety standards that mutually differ to a large extent. Some of the differences of the requirements for safety devices, including the requirements for their functionality, are compared and commented on in this chapter. Moreover, attention is paid to the use of asphalt surfaces on roads and sidewalks in tunnels. This chapter also describes the approach to fire ventilation in tunnels, one of the most significant safety devices. Special attention is paid to the choice of the strategy of longitudinal ventilation, which has been the subject of many discussions. This chapter outlines the possible directions for a solution in the future.

Today Russia implements two different approaches to managing the Northern Sea Route (NSR). The first one entails signaling openness for international cooperation, foreign investments and cargo with the aim to develop the NSR into a globally competitive maritime route. Such approach is evident both from the statements of the high-ranking Russian officials and the strategic documents dedicated to the Arctic region. The other pattern is reflected in Russia’s willingness to impose limitations on foreign shipping on the Route. In addition to the permission-based national regime for navigation on the NSR, since 2018, Russia has ruled out certain maritime activities on the Route carried out by vessels flying non-Russian flags. Further measures for ships built outside Russia, as well as foreign warships, are being discussed. Taken together, these trends could lead to a suggestion that Russia sees the future development of the Northern Sea Route in attracting foreign investments and cargo, but not the vessels. However, additional layer of inconsistency emerges in Moscow’s attempts to justify the harsh national permission-based regime and national measures aimed at limiting foreign shipping on the NSR. The main argument by the Russian authorities is the special responsibility of the coastal state for the safety of navigation and protection of the marine environment. Yet, the practice indicates that the state is sometimes reluctant to keep high environmental and safety standards – both due to the lack of efficient law enforcement mechanisms and possible unwillingness to challenge the economic development of the region. The article concludes with the suggestion that Russia will need to more clearly decide the future course of development for the NSR and adjust the navigation regime and law enforcement mechanisms accordingly.

At the Institute for Reference Materials and Measurements (European commission, Joint Research Centre, IRMM) a dismantling campaign of obsolete installations and glove boxes has been carried out in 2005. There were various reasons for their removal. Some large installations did not meet modern safety standards, other installations were worn out and expected to cause a radioactive contamination risk in the future. The main goal was to create as less waste as possible by extensive contamination checks and by decontamination if necessary. For the glove boxes, decontamination was not possible. A controlled area was set up around the installation to be dismantled in order to prevent spreading of contamination from dust and dirt. This was only possible for the “minor” contaminated installations. The dismantling campaign of the glove boxes was carried out by using tents of two types depending the contamination inside the glove boxes. The most common glove boxes were dismantled in a tent constructed with hard surfaced polycarbonate plates (ventilated cell). For glove boxes with higher contamination, the same principle was used but with a second “glove box tent” inside (ventilated glove tent). The purpose of this project was to learn from the experience of this campaign which gave the ability to make estimates of future radioactive waste or classic waste that could be expected from dismantled installations.

Our attitudes towards the risks of climate change must be reconsidered. We must recognise that the consequences will be huge and inevitable if we do not act now. Better to accept a few false alarms rather than be unprepared for a climate catastrophe. An outstanding example is the calculation by groups from Germany and the UK in 2009 (1) of the allowable emissions of CO2 before a 2°C increase in global temperature is exceeded. This leaves very little time, only 4 to 8 years, for mitigation measures. Nuclear fission now presents a formidable fleet of some 450 reactors benefitting from over 50 years of operational experience. Throughout decades of development, they reached outstanding safety standards, exceeding those of most renewable sources. However, the threat of climate change is calling this perspective into question as nuclear technology requires long-term stability of institutions. The future of nuclear fission will be determined after the expiration of the next decade with the development of hydro, solar and wind energy as replacements. For Croatia, in view of future climate insecurity, we cannot recommend the construction of a nuclear power plant built to operate from 2043 to 2083 (2) as a replacement for the outgoing NE Krško plant. Instead, we should intensify the development of our renewable resources.
